Test Background
Flexible plastic pipes deform under load, thereby reducing stress on the pipe wall and reducing the chance of pipe failure due to brittle cracking. Therefore, flexibility and stiffness are of great importance to rubber and plastic hoses. The rubber and plastic hose bend test measures the stiffness and flexibility of rubber and plastic hoses and non-reinforced hoses when they are bent to a specific radius below room temperature.

Test method
1. Method A is applicable to non-foldable rubber and plastic hoses and non-reinforced hoses with an inner diameter of less than 25 mm (including 25 mm). This method provides a method for measuring the stiffness of hoses or unreinforced hoses at temperatures below standard test chamber temperatures.
2. Method B is applicable to rubber and plastic hoses and non-reinforced hoses with an inner diameter of less than 100 mm, and provides a method for evaluating their flexibility when bending around a mandrel at temperatures below room temperature. Can also be used as a routine quality control test.
3. Method C is applicable to rubber and plastic hoses and non-reinforced hoses with an inner diameter of more than 100 mm (including 100 mm). This method gives a method for measuring the stiffness of hoses and unreinforced hoses at temperatures below room temperature. This method is only applicable to non-collapsible hoses and non-reinforced hoses.
Test standard:
GB/T 5565.2-2017 Rubber and plastic hoses and unreinforced hoses - Measurement of flexibility and stiffness - Part 2: Bend test below room temperature
ISO 10619 2-2011 Rubber and plastic hoses and pipes - Measurement of flexibility and stiffness - Part 2: Bend test below ambient temperature
EN ISO 4672-1999 Rubber and plastic hoses Flexibility test below room temperature
BS EN ISO 10619-2-2021 Rubber or plastic hoses and fittings. Measurement of flexibility and stiffness. Bending test at sub-ambient temperatures
NF T47-203-2-2012 Rubber and plastic hoses and pipes - Measurement of flexibility and stiffness - Part 2: Bend test below ambient temperature
DIN EN ISO 10619-2-2012 Rubber and plastic hoses and pipes. Measurement of flexibility and rigidity Part 2: Bend test below ambient temperature
